Is Remotelock the Best Solution for Contactless Check-In?
The demand for touchless check-in in the worldwide hotel business increased by 75% during the COVID-19 outbreak. Driven by the public health crisis in 2020, this trend increased demand for substitutes for conventional key cards. Data reveal that on average each visitor spends 4 minutes manually checking in, which lowers efficiency and increases the possibility of possible health concerns by 20%. For instance, Hilton Hotels Group's 2021 research revealed that moving to an intelligent system could save 30% of operational time and lower the risk of infection transmission by 15%. This has driven the industry to investigate several options, including the Remotelock system, which was deployed in more than 10,000 houses throughout the epidemic and simplified check-in processes by means of automated means.
Remotelock's low cost and operational efficiency enhancement are its main advantages. An industry study in 2022 says the system can cut the check-in cycle to 30 seconds, raise efficiency by 50%, and save hotels an average of $500 in annual expenses. For example, once Airbnb hosts started using it, the return on investment peaked at 20% and the failure rate remained below 5%. Technically, this system supports remote key delivery, incorporates Internet of Things (iot) devices, and runs at a frequency of up to 60 times per minute, thereby lowering 90% of manual intervention. Regarding security risk management, it does very well. Following Remotelock's deployment in the Marriott Group real case of 2023, guest satisfaction rose by 12 percentage points, showing its constant load ability in heavily traveled surroundings.
Remotelock shows greater accuracy and dependability than other touchless solutions, like QR code based applications, though. While the remotelock system boasts 98% accuracy with a response time under 0.5 seconds, thereby lowering the peak waiting time for visitors by 40%, data shows that the average error rate of QR code check-in is 15%. In the 2021 pilot project at Singapore Airport, for example, after implementing this technology, the security check flow increased by 20%, and the operation cycle rose from an average of 1,000 people per day to 1,200 people. But as the competitive scene heats up, the beginning cost of mobile application solutions like Kisi is as little as $100, while the installation price per unit of Remotelock is around $500, perhaps causing budget pressure on small companies and need an evaluation of the total life cycle cost.
Naturally, Remotelock has possible hazards as well, like a 10% rise in the likelihood of cyberattack breaches. The data leak at a specific hotel chain in 2023 brought this issue to light when security compliance costs climbed by 25%. Fluctuations in temperature or humidity may shorten the lifetime of equipment, averaging three years, which is somewhat shorter than the four years of conventional systems. Professional training is necessary for the complexity of operation. Surveys show that 20% of failures result from user error rates, therefore impacting total efficiency. Furthermore reducing return on investment were hardware prices' 15% rise brought about by economic crises like world inflation in 2022. To strike returns and security, one must improve risk management systems.
In essence, a thorough evaluation of its advantages and downsides will determine whether Remotelock is viewed as the best answer. Over the following five years, the contactless technology sector is anticipated to have a compound annual growth rate of 12%, according to overall industry data, and this solution has greatly contributed in terms of large-scale application and efficiency improvement. From a statistical point of view, the median user distribution's satisfaction rate is 85%, with a rather modest variance. Suggested among the integrated solutions, this one has to be modified to fit with regional rules and resource limitations.
